[This post starts with a picture of the shore at Olivine, sun beaming down, a Chikorita curled up in the sand to take it in.]
I have been enjoying my life in this realm so far! It has already been over half of a year since I arrived, and yet, it does not feel like so much time has passed at all.
While it is a bit lonely at times, I have found many delights to rejoice in, and today I encountered yet another one that I wish to share.
[Next comes...pictures of sandwiches. Really pretty sandwiches. Very tasty sandwiches. Honestly, they're the kind you get at the PokeMart for a couple hundred Pokedollars, but with that said, they seem quite nice!]
I am not...skilled...when it comes to cooking. Why, before coming here, I must confess that I had burned boiling water a few times while on kitchen duty. My companion taught me how to prepare potatoes, but a young lady cannot subsist on potatoes alone. So, my meals often come from the local stores here.
And these sandwiches...
They are simply divine!
So much beauty and flavor in a tiny package!
I did not know the simple art of preparation could enhance an experience, and yet it has!
But the most incredible sandwich of them all has to be this one!
[Next is a picture of...oh. A lot of fruit and cream sandwiches. Some are being snacked on by Pokemon, but there's still more. Holy crap, Flayn, how many did you buy?]
I have never before encountered a sandwich one can eat for dessert!
The fruit is wonderfully bright against the cream, like...like gems of flavor!
And the fact that there is whipped cream holding it together is so unexpected, but so perfect!
It is much like a fruit and cream cake, but you can hold it in your hand and not make a mess! And the bread tastes good with it, too!
Are there more dessert sandwiches in this world? I have seen images of an "iced cream sandwich", and while I am familiar with iced cream, I am not sure how well it could hold its shape as a sandwich. But oh, if there are more, please tell me!
I want my Pokemon and I to try them all!
